How to Make Easy Avocado Deviled Eggs
To make easy avocado deviled eggs, you will need the following ingredients:
- 6 hard-boiled eggs
- 1 avocado
- 1/2 cup mayonnaise
- 1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
- 1 teaspoon lemon juice
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/8 teaspoon black pepper
- Chopped chives or paprika, for garnish
Instructions:
- Hard-boil the eggs according to the package directions.
- Once the eggs are cool, peel them and cut them in half lengthwise.
- Scoop out the yolks and place them in a bowl.
- Mash the yolks with a fork until they are smooth.
- Add the avocado, mayonnaise, Dijon mustard, lemon juice, salt, and pepper to the bowl.
- Mix well until the ingredients are combined.
- Spoon the filling back into the egg whites.
- Garnish with chopped chives or paprika.
Avocado deviled eggs can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
